Which Types of Home Additions Are Most Common?

Common home additions include extra bedrooms, expanded kitchens, larger living areas, new garages, and master suite expansions that create more functional space for daily life.

Bedroom additions help accommodate children, guests, or aging parents who need their own space. Kitchen expansions open up cramped layouts and improve flow during meal prep and family gatherings.

Garage additions provide covered parking, storage, and workshop areas that keep vehicles and tools protected from weather. Each type of addition requires careful framing and structural planning to integrate safely with the existing foundation and roofline.

How Do You Match an Addition to Your Home's Style?

Matching an addition starts with analyzing roofline angles, siding materials, window styles, and exterior colors so the new space looks intentional rather than tacked on.

Roof pitch and overhang details are replicated to maintain consistent proportions. Siding is either matched exactly or chosen to complement the original material without clashing.

Window placement and trim styles are coordinated to create visual balance across the entire facade. Interior finishes like flooring and trim are also selected to flow naturally from existing rooms into the new space.

What Structural Work Supports a Safe Addition?

Safe additions require proper foundation work, load-bearing framing, and connections to existing walls that distribute weight evenly and meet local building codes.

Footings and foundation walls must be poured to the correct depth to prevent settling or cracking. Framing members are sized and spaced according to engineering standards that account for roof load, wind, and snow.

Connections between old and new sections are reinforced to prevent separation or stress cracks. Licensed contractors ensure every step meets code requirements and is inspected at key stages.

How Do Kankakee Weather Patterns Affect Addition Planning?

Kankakee experiences cold winters with snow loads, warm humid summers, and seasonal storms that require careful attention to roof design, insulation, and drainage during addition planning.

Roof framing must handle snow accumulation without sagging, and insulation levels should match or exceed existing sections to maintain energy efficiency. Gutters and grading are adjusted to direct water away from both old and new foundations.

Choosing materials that expand and contract with temperature changes reduces the risk of gaps or leaks over time. Proper planning ensures your addition performs well year-round without weather-related issues.
